Kim was included for the first time on the publication’s list of the World’s Billionaires.The actress, whose marriage to Kanye ended, has been going through a difficult time in recent months. This is a huge boost for her. Forbes reports in a special article about Kim that her fortune has increased to more than $1 billion (£700 million) from $780 million (£562 million) in October. The article credits Kim’s Business brands KKW Beauty and Skims with pushing her over the billionaire threshold.

Kylie Jenner, Kim’s younger half-sister, was also on Forbes’ Billionaires list one year ago, but she was taken off the list just a few weeks later.
